  4. Trades Processed: 1038
    Trades Taken: 634
    Partial Trades Taken: 0
    Trades Rejected: 404
    .........................................

    Not a realistic test. Trades were rejected probably due to a lack of funds (fully invested)

    You need to take every single trade if you want to test a mechanical system.
